#653489 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#653489 is composed of 39.6% red, 20.4%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.3% cyan, 62%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 274.6 degrees, a saturation of 45% and a lightness of 37.1%. #653489 color hex could be obtained by blending #ca68ff with #000013.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#653489 color description : Dark moderate violet.

#653489 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#653489 has RGB values of R:101, G:52,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 6632585.
